• Image ID #2673026

  • Dimension: 4096x2304px.

  • Size: 4MB

Woman smiling at a polling station in spain with a spanish flag in the background, signified by the vote sign and electoral posters displayed indoors in a well-lit room.

You can also download this image at:

StockImages